  • Moderators, Computer Games Moderators, Social & Fun Moderators Posts: 18,543 Mod ✭✭✭✭Kimbot


    dudeeile wrote: »
    Tis a tricky one, I'd just backup the drive and then chance throwing it into the pro to see what happens, you never know.

    It formats dude, the PS console then encodes the HDD with the PS's serial number etc to allow it to run on that PS.

    External HDD is the way to do this.

    Used to LOVE C.O.D. Fell out with it for several reasons but just reading this morning on what Activision have done in relation to the most recent edition.


    Digitally Packaged MW remastered (which everyone wanted) with MW Infinite (which very few wanted) and sold it as the deluxe version.
    Sales by volume were down by 50% (on Blops III) but revenue up by 25% as a result. (not sure how accurate this is)
    Released a DLC for MWR at €15 which was more than the cost when they released the same DLC ten years ago.
    Released separate weapon & cosmetic DLC for MWR that you had to buy.
    Are now releasing MWR as a standalone title for €40! without the DLC!!!!
    All this within 8-9 months since MW Infinite released.
